Sixteen Best Web Scraping Tools For Data Extraction In 2020
In essence, what we would be building is an search engine optimization tool that accepts a search keyword as enter after which scrapes the related keywords for you. Just in case you have no idea, Google related keywords are keyword ideas discovered below search engine listing. GoogleScraper – A Python module to scrape different search engines by using proxies (socks4/5, http proxy). The tool includes asynchronous networking assist and is ready to control actual browsers to mitigate detection. Behaviour primarily based detection is the most troublesome protection system.
To prevent any type of a block, you need to extend the bot to use proxies. You may even go additional to scrape related questions in addition to key phrases.
And it’s all the identical with other search engines like google as nicely. Most of the things that work proper now will quickly turn into a factor of the past. In that case, when you’ll keep on relying on an outdated methodology of scraping SERP knowledge, you’ll be lost among the many trenches.
However, Anysite Scraper is the one tool that may extract data from all these websites and save your money and time. Moreover, you’ll be able to create your own customized scraper with Anysite Web Scraper and also you don’t need to learn particular programming abilities to build an internet extractor. You can construct your own customized Facebook scraper, Yellow Pages Extractor, Twitter Scraper, and so forth. With extra data on the net, it turns into tougher to track and use this info. Complicating matters, this info is spread throughout billions of net-pages, each with its own structure and structure.
Also, if you want to gather an e mail tackle or cellphone numbers of customers, you can do that with Web Data Scraper. Search engine scraping might be helpful to scrape search engine results and retailer them in a textual content file, Spreadsheets or database. This is a selected type of internet scraping, Data Crawling dedicated to search engines like google only. You can then compile this data for analysis, analysis, or any number of functions.
We would have data and data all over the place – left, right, and center! Search engines got here in to make every thing orderly, organized, and above all, they made knowledge easily accessible. To remain relevant in this present market place, you should say goodbye to the handbook assortment of data. You will spend years amassing all of the very important information you need. In this age and era, guide data assortment ought to be a factor of the past.
All great search engine optimization device comes with a search keyword rating characteristic. The tools will let you know how your key phrases are performing in google, yahoo bing and so forth. The truth is, you cannot use this tool to scrape thousands of key phrases as Google will discover you might be using a bot and can block you.
So how do you discover and gather the desired data you’re in search of in a helpful format – and do it quickly and easily without breaking the bank? You can gather data from search engines, social media, business directories, and information scraping instruments or you can buy knowledge from information provider corporations. When it involves scraping search engines like google, Google search engine is by far probably the most priceless source of information to scrape. Google crawls the web continously in the goal of providing customers with recent content material.
Crawling Google search outcomes can be needed for numerous causes, like checking web site rankings for search engine optimization, crawling pictures for machine learning, scraping flights, jobs or product reviews. Google’s supremacy in search engines is so massive that folks often wonder the way to scrape information from Google search outcomes. While scraping isn’t allowed as per their phrases of use, Google does provide another and legit method of capturing search results. If you hear yourself ask, “Is there a Google Search API?
In Scrapy Python Tutorial, you’ll study to scrape internet knowledge from web sites using scrapy library. The custom scraper comes with roughly 30 search engines like google and yahoo already educated, so to get started you merely need to plug in your keywords and begin it working or use the included Keyword Scraper. There’s even an engine for YouTube to harvest YouTube video URL’s and Alexa Topsites to harvest domains with the very best visitors rankings.
In essence you’re churning via their info as shortly as attainable to harvest information in an automatic fashion, but they want you to browse like a standard human being. In contrast, web crawling has traditionally been used by the nicely-known search engines like google and yahoo (e.g. Google, Bing, and so forth.) to obtain and index the online. These companies have constructed a good reputation through the years, because they’ve constructed indispensable tools that add worth to the websites they crawl.
10 b2b social media strategies that work for any industry on these IP addresses and are promising clients that they’ll work, but when you get a lot of them banned, you may need a lot of explaining to do with the provider. No matter the business you might be doing, scraping will maintain you aggressive and on high of your sport and trade.
One potential reason could be that search engines like google like Google are getting virtually all their information by scraping hundreds of thousands of public reachable web sites, additionally with out studying and accepting these phrases. A legal case received by Google in opposition to Microsoft would possibly put their entire business as risk.
The actuality is that the majority of these search engines have a threshold. I can’t typically scrape quite a lot of pages of Google — 5 at most — until I get my first captcha. Once that occurs I scale back threads and enhance timeout, after which go on till I get one other captcha. There are numerous reasons search engines like google don’t want you to scrape.
Proxies are essential in terms of search engine scraping. Truth be informed, without proxies scraping will virtually be impossible. Search engines don’t want you to scrape and acquire vast quantities of knowledge in simply a short time.
Unlike scraping a website, a search engine won’t be as simple as it sounds. Sure, primarily you want a scraper, but there are some things to bear in mind. As search engines evolved, so did their protection towards misuse. A search engine is for finding 9 factors that affect your email deliverability something, not for grabbing everything you possibly can, but that doesn’t mean that you can’t do it. Just like search engines, scraping data is something that has been round for fairly a while.
When you scrape search engines, and also you’re severe about it, I only recommend rotating proxies. They are much the experts guide to email marketing less of a hassle, and throw up flags means less than free, datacenter or shared proxies.
When growing a search engine scraper there are a number of existing tools and libraries out there that can both be used, prolonged or simply analyzed to learn from. You can find the main points of customers particularly locality be searching by way of the white pages of that area.
You can also use an organization name to look patents that a company has struggled. This could be helpful in case you attempt tracking rivals or want to grasp who may be an excellent permitting partner for the inventions. Being older than Google, most individuals might suppose that they have higher standards and higher safety when it comes to scraping. The best method is to start slowly and start to improve. It would possibly take extra time, however that method, you should have little if any IPs blacklisted and still get the outcomes you need.
Beyond The Census: Using Census Data In Public Libraries
Unlike the various search engines, scraping has advanced quite a bit since it initially got here to be. Every time you resolve to scrape a search engine, ensure that you employ the proper scraping proxies. Typically, search engines like google and yahoo will try to block any scraper. Search engines assume that any person utilizing the device is doing it for the mistaken reasons.
It’S Time For The Biggest Sourcing Change In Two Decades
Google, the large dog, feels that it might slow down websites’ responsiveness, but we all know they just don’t need folks to entry all their knowledge. The issue with scraping search engines like google and yahoo is that they don’t need you to do it.
Google provides an API to get search outcomes, so why scraping google anonymously as an alternative of utilizing Google API? Have you wondered how google fetch the info from entire World Wide Web and index it in search engine? It is called scraping which is the method of knowledge extraction from web sites in an automated trend. Web scraping is an effective method of gathering knowledge from webpages, it has become an efficient software in data science.
NOW RELEASED! 🍃 💧 🍇 🍉 Health Food Shops Email List – B2B Mailing List of Health Shops! https://t.co/ExFx1qFe4O
Our Health Food Shops Email List will connect your business with health food stores locally, nationally or internationally. pic.twitter.com/H0UDae6fhc
— Creative Bear Tech (@CreativeBearTec) October 14, 2019
For you to succeed as a marketer, you must make knowledge together with your greatest pal. If you continue a brand new scrape with that IP, which Google has now flagged, it’ll likely get banned from Google, and then blacklisted. Google and other engines need humans to look the net, not bots. So, if your bot doesn’t act like a human, you will get booted.
- Moreover, you can create your individual customized scraper with Anysite Web Scraper and you need not learn particular programming skills to construct an online extractor.
- You can find many tools on the Internet to extract website knowledge but you can’t find such applications that may extract knowledge from all social networking websites, forums, and business listing sites.
- You should purchase a separate net data extractor for every social media web site and business listing.
- However, Anysite Scraper is the one tool that may extract information from all these websites and save your money and time.
Search engine scraping is not one thing new; it is an historical practice which may be as old because the internet. The software program is designed to search the internet in a given systematic way according to a textual question.
This is why Anysite Web Page Extractor is the most well-liked, most used, and distinctive information mining device. The Web Harvesting software automatically extracts data from the web and captures where the major search engines have stopped, doing the work that the search engine can’t do. The information extraction instruments automate the reading, copying, and pasting wanted to gather information for later use. The internet scraper program simulates human interaction with the web site and collects data in a way as if the website had been being browsed. Build an online scraper that scrapes Google associated keywords and write them right into a text file.
Search engines serve their pages to hundreds of thousands of customers every single day, this supplies a large amount of behaviour data. Google for example has a really refined behaviour analyzation system, possibly using deep learning software to detect uncommon patterns of entry. It can detect unusual activity a lot sooner than different search engines like google. While Google may present and construction the ends in the best possible method, Bing will allow you to scrape all day without asking any questions.
— Creative Bear Tech (@CreativeBearTec) May 14, 2020
This advanced net scraper permits extracting information is as easy as clicking the information you want. It allows you to obtain your scraped data in any format for analysis. The downside with scraping is whenever you need to scrape more than one search engine, including local version of that search engine. Automated scraping — grabbing search results using your individual ‘bot’— violates every search engine’s terms of service.
We are beginning this with the most popular and the most tough search engine for scraping. Being the most popular additionally means that it’s the most advanced, so you’ll face plenty of obstacles when trying to scrape information from there. Sessions are the number of “digital scrapers” that might be making the requests and grabbing the information. In the olden days, individuals would scrape knowledge off of websites manually by copying and pasting the info.
You can find many tools on the Internet to extract website data however you cannot discover such packages that may extract data from all social networking websites, forums, and enterprise listing websites. You have to buy a separate internet information extractor for each social media site and enterprise directory.
As the amount of knowledge saved growing the process of scraping, it turned increasingly sophisticated, and that resulted in the creation of scrapers. Deploying different proxies to search for the same keywords can, at occasions, be damaging. To guarantee random knowledge entry, set divergent proxy fee limits.
Blockchain and Cryptocurrency Email List for B2B Marketinghttps://t.co/FcfdYmSDWG
Our Database of All Cryptocurrency Sites contains the websites, emails, addresses, phone numbers and social media links of practically all cryptocurrency sites including ICO, news sites. pic.twitter.com/WeHHpGCpcF
— Creative Bear Tech (@CreativeBearTec) June 16, 2020
Different Types Of Google Patents Scraping Services
Stagger your requests, and you will nonetheless gather data in a quicker way than utilizing the standard strategies of collecting knowledge. Don’t be in a rush to gather all the data you want in only a single day; you continue to have some extra time. Author Bio
About the Author: Zelmira is a blogger at cbdhempworldusa, kygolf.org and nationalcarefinancial.
Telephone:+39 085 950523,+39 340 1112368,+39 085 950524,00866460678,+39 085 950523
Address: The Forum, 277 London RoadBurgess Hill
As Featured in
https://www.forever21.comYour person agent tells extra about your working system and browser. This is usually the case when using totally different search operators in a single search.
Instead, they need you to browse the internet like some other human beings. Scraping search engines is an age-old tradition — no less than as old because the web. Because the various search engines have categorized the data in such a great way, a dialed in scrape can flip up tens of millions of results for keywords, URLs, and other metrics in a number of hours. ScrapeBox has a custom search engine scraper which could be trained to reap URL’s from nearly any website that has a search feature.
Put a high timeout, maybe seconds, and start from there. Also, don’t go all-in with hundreds of sessions – begin with a number of and gradually add extra sessions and start to lower the timeout. At a certain level, you’ll reach the restrict and will start to get your IP addresses blacklisted, and that is not one thing you wish to do.
Go to the settings and select the proper setting in your question frequency. When this happens, you have to get a alternative and proceed scraping. Search engines categorize data in an organized method, and a bot will be able to gather specific info from quite a few URLs in just a few hours.
The more you use these operators, the more probably you are to be caught. Avoid utilizing these operators completely or stay low-key. The question frequency refers back to the price at which the proxy will be sending the requests.
— Creative Bear Tech (@CreativeBearTec) June 16, 2020
The largest public identified incident of a search engine being scraped happened in 2011 when Microsoft was caught scraping unknown keywords from Google for their very own, rather new Bing service. () But even this incident didn’t lead to a court docket case. The more key phrases a consumer needs to scrape and the smaller the time for the job the tougher scraping might be and the more developed a scraping script or device needs to be. Be aware of which scraper you select because not all of them can scrape from search engines. ScrapeBox, Netpeak Checker, and Scraping Expert are only a handful of scrapers that may grab data out of search engines like google.
Regardless of which you plan to seize knowledge from, make certain to fantastic-tune your scraper and make micro-modifications to the settings to have the ability to get one of the best results in the shortest time. Most of the other search engines like google and yahoo are someplace in-between.
Making the net scraper multitask in other to scrape extra pages at a time may also make it better. While that language is solid, this subject is greatest illustrated by the lawsuit LinkedIn took out towards 100 anonymous knowledge scrapers who did what you’re making an attempt to do but did it poorly. The verdict of the case has not been decided on the time of writing, and it brings up many points around scraping that are beyond the purview of this text.
So web crawling is mostly seen more favorably, although it could sometimes be utilized in abusive methods as nicely. If you don’t have entry to classy know-how, it is unimaginable to scrape search engines like google, Bing or Yahoo.
Search engine efficiency is a very important metric all digital marketers want to measure and enhance. I’m certain you may be utilizing some great search engine optimization instruments to verify how your keywords carry out.
Search And Harvest
Effective search engine scraping will require some particular person abilities; in any other case, you may find yourself having your scraper detected, and your proxy blocked. To be clear, the above eventualities and numbers are true once I use premium rotating proxies.